Dodecahedron[ <Point A>, <Point B>, <Direction> ]
Creates a dodecahedron having segment AB as an edge.
The other vertices are univocally determined by the given direction, that needs to be:
  • a vector, a segment, a line, a ray orthogonal to AB, or
  • a polygon, a plane parallel to AB.
The created dodecahedron will have:
  • a face with edge AB in a plane orthogonal to the given vector/segment/line/ray, or
  • a face with edge AB in a plane parallel to the polygon/plane.
Dodecahedron[ <Point A>, <Point B>]
Creates a dodecahedron having segment AB as an edge, and a face contained in a plane parallel to xOy plane.
Note: This syntax is a shortcut for Dodecahedron[ <Point A>, <Point B>, xOyPlane], which requires that AB is parallel to xOy plane.
